The Poppy Land Limited Express.
The first train leaves at 6 p. m. For the land where the poppy blows; And mother dear is the engineer, And the passenger laughs and crows. The palace car is the mother’s arms, The whistle a low, sweet strain; The passenger winks, and nods, and blinks, And goes to sleep in the train. At 8 p. m. the next train starts For the poppy land afar; The summons clear fall on the ear—- “ All aboard for the sleeping car!” So I ask of Him who the children took On His knee in kindness great, “Take charge, I pray, of the trains each day, That leave at 6 and 8. Keep watch of the passengers,’’ thus I pray, “For»to me they are very dear; And special ward, O gracious Lord, O’er the gentle engineer.” —Edgar Wade Abbott.
